Пример #1
0
        private void Executebtn_Click(object sender, EventArgs e)
        {
            using (var db = new LundellsBookstoreContext())
            {
                string valdbok = BookSelect.SelectedItem.ToString();
                int    antal   = Int32.Parse(AntalSelect.Text.ToString());

                foreach (var book in booklist)
                {
                    if (valdbok == book.Titel)
                    {
                        var item = (Lagersaldo)db.Lagersaldos.Select(i => i).Where(i => i.Isbn == book.Isbn13).First();

                        if (item.ButikId == storeID)
                        {
                            if (RadioKöp.Checked)
                            {
                                item.Antal += antal;
                            }
                            else if (RadioSälj.Checked)
                            {
                                item.Antal -= antal;
                            }
                            db.Lagersaldos.Update(item);
                        }
                    }
                }
                db.SaveChanges();
                BookSelect.DataSource = booklist.Select(i => i.Titel).ToList();
            }
        }
Пример #2
0
 public Köpsälj()
 {
     InitializeComponent();
     storeID = BaseForm.butikslista.Where(i => i.Butiksnamn == selectedstore).Select(i => i.IdentityId).First();
     using (var db = new LundellsBookstoreContext())
     {
         foreach (var item in db.Böckers.Select(i => i).Where(i => i.Lagersaldos.Any(i => i.ButikId == storeID)))
         {
             booklist.Add(item);
         }
         BookSelect.DataSource = booklist.Select(i => i.Titel).ToList();
     }
 }
Пример #3
0
        public BaseForm()
        {
            InitializeComponent();
            using (var db = new LundellsBookstoreContext())

            {
                foreach (var butik in db.Butikers)
                {
                    butikslista.Add(butik);
                }
                StoreSelect.DataSource = butikslista.Select(i => i.Butiksnamn).ToList();
            }
        }